UN official: Regional interaction to fight drugs, smuggling continue

He made the remarks in closing ceremony for Tehran International Conference on Cooperation against Illicit Drugs and Related Organized Crimes on Monday afternoon.

Fedotov appreciated Iranian government for holding such important conference, and said that the international interactions in this concern should be continued.

He called the discussed issues in the conference useful and added that many of the conference outcomes will be proposed and considered in Vienna meeting.

Interior Minister and Secretary General of Anti-Drug Headquarters Abdolreza Rahmani Fazli expressed satisfaction for outcomes of the conference and added that the sum up of talks were comprehensive and appropriate.

He asked member-countries to take bigger steps for cooperation in this field.

The minister also expressed Iran’s readiness to host similar conferences in the field of fight against drugs trafficking.

Tehran International Conference on Cooperation against Illicit Drugs and Related Organized Crime kicked off on Monday morning in Hotel Espinas Palace and in addition to Iran’s Interior Minister Rahmani Fazli, representatives and officials from 25 countries and eight international organizations attended the conference.
